Description
This Marry Me Chicken Orzo is a delightful one-pot meal that combines tender chicken with creamy orzo, sun-dried tomatoes, and spinach in a flavorful sauce. It’s a comforting and satisfying dish perfect for a cozy dinner.
Ingredients

For the Chicken:
- 4 boneless skinless chicken thighs or breasts
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
For the Orzo:
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 3 cloves garlic (minced)
- 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
- 1/2 cup sun-dried tomatoes (chopped)
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 cup orzo pasta (uncooked)
- 2 cups chicken broth
- 1/2 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 cups baby spinach
- Chopped fresh basil or parsley for garnish
Instructions
- Season the Chicken: Season the chicken with sal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
- Sear the Chicken: Heat olive oil in a large deep skillet or Dutch oven. Sear the chicken on both sides until golden. Remove and set aside.
- Prepare the Orzo: In the same pan, melt butter and sauté garlic and red pepper flakes. Add sun-dried tomatoes, oregano, thyme, and orzo. Pour in chicken broth and simmer until orzo is al dente.
- Finish the Dish: Stir in cream and Parmesan. Add spinach, return chicken to the pan. Warm through. Garnish with basil or parsley.
Notes
- For extra richness, use boneless thighs instead of breasts.
- You can also add mushrooms or swap spinach for kale.
- This dish reheats well and makes great leftovers.
